Determining the Cost-Effectiveness of Roof Repairs versus Replacement

When evaluating the most economical approach for your roof, it is essential to consider various factors that can impact the overall cost-effectiveness of the project. Here are key points to keep in mind:

  • Extent of Damage: Assess the extent of damage to determine if repairs are sufficient or if a replacement is more cost-effective in the long run.
  • Age of the Roof: The age of your roof plays a crucial role in decision-making, as older roofs may require frequent repairs, making a replacement a more viable option.
  • Energy Efficiency: Consider the energy efficiency of your roof, as newer materials may provide better insulation and reduce long-term heating and cooling costs.

Estimated Costs for Roof Repairs and Replacements in Orlando, FL

When considering the upkeep of your dwelling in Orlando, Florida, it is vital to assess the potential expenses linked to roof maintenance. The climate in this region can lead to wear and tear on roofs, necessitating timely repairs or replacements to uphold the structural integrity of your abode.

  • Roof repair costs can vary based on the extent of the damage and the materials used. On average, minor repairs may range from $300 to $1,000, while more extensive repairs could cost between $1,000 and $4,000.
  • Roof replacement expenses, on the other hand, are typically higher due to the labor-intensive nature of the task. A full roof replacement in Orlando might total anywhere from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the roof and the materials chosen.

It is crucial to note that delaying necessary repairs can lead to further damage and escalate costs in the long run. By addressing minor issues promptly, homeowners can prevent the need for more extensive and costly repairs down the line.

Expert Tips for Roof Maintenance in Orlando:

  1. Regularly inspect your roof for signs of damage, such as missing shingles, leaks, or sagging areas.
  2. Keep gutters clean to ensure proper drainage and prevent water from seeping under the roof.
  3. Trim overhanging branches to avoid debris buildup and potential damage to the roof.

Understanding the Return on Investment (ROI) of Roof Repairs Versus Replacements

When considering the best approach to maintaining your roof, it’s essential to weigh the potential return on investment (ROI) of repairs versus full replacements. Both options have their advantages and drawbacks, and a strategic decision can save you significant costs in the long run. Let’s delve into the nuances of this crucial consideration:

  • Pros of Roof Repairs
    • Immediate cost savings
    • Targeted fixes for specific issues
    • Preservation of the existing roof structure
  • Cons of Roof Repairs
    • Ongoing maintenance needs may arise
    • Short-term solution for potentially extensive damage
    • May not address underlying structural issues
  • Pros of Roof Replacements
    • Long-term durability and reliability
    • Enhanced energy efficiency with modern materials
    • Potential increase in property value
  • Cons of Roof Replacements
    • Higher upfront costs
    • Disruption during installation process
    • Environmental impact of disposing of the old roof

It’s crucial to assess factors like the age of your current roof, extent of damage, local climate conditions, and your long-term property ownership goals.
